> > >>    Which Nvidia driver? Which Nvidia card? I've had problems with the
> > >> newer Nvidia driver on my Ti4600 so I stay back at the 6111 driver.
> > >> On FC1 I had to install the 5328 driver first and then upgrade to the
> > >> 6111 driver to get it to work though. On FC2 I can install 6111
> > >> without first installing 5328. The newest driver (6629?) I can't get
> > >> to work unless I patch it, so I'm just staying at 6111 for right now.

> >can you post your xorg.conf?
> >
> >i'm pretty sure you need to set "NvAGP" to "3" in order to use the
> >nvidia 3d acceleration. you'll also need to turn "direct rendering" on
> >in your bios.
